Al-Riddah and the Muslim Conquest of Arabia. Book Description: In a detailed analysis of the political forces then at work, Dr.
Shoufani shows the tremendous influence of the Meccan aristocracy on the policies of Muhammad in his last two years, on his adoption of the northern strategy aimed at invading Syria, and later, on the election of Abu.

The Ridda Wars (Arabic: حُرُوب ٱلرِّدَّة ), also known as the Wars of Apostasy, were a series of military campaigns launched by the Caliph Abu Bakr against rebel Arabian tribes during andjust after the death of the Islamic Prophet Muhammad.
